Get one from Ford... My last one from there was only like $25.. Don't get the newer grey CPS though... I don't know what will come up for the '94.5, but i know for my '95 they don't sell the grey, they sell a good one that is dark grey w/ a bluish purple o-ring. These are better than the grey CPS they have now.
